Lecture: Roger Waters and His Views on Human Rights, Israel-Palestine Conflict, and More
Introduction
Speaker: Roger Waters, renowned musician from Pink Floyd
Topics discussed include human rights, Israel-Palestine conflict, and various viewpoints on political issues like Putin, Donald Trump, and cancel culture.
Roger Waters' Stand on Human Rights
Waters emphasizes he is serious about human rights and not deterred by powerful opposition.
Believes all Palestinians should have the same human and legal rights as Israeli Jews.
Two-State Solution and Alternatives
Waters is skeptical about the feasibility of a two-state solution given the current circumstances.
He advocates for all people in the region to live together with equal human rights.
Keynes debates with Waters over the idea of a unified Democratic state for all Israelis and Palestinians.
Waters insists that armed resistance by Palestinians against occupation is a legal and moral right.
Eric Clapton on Roger Waters
Eric Clapton praises Waters for his courage and passion for human rights.
Waters and Clapton have a long-standing friendship with mutual respect despite differing viewpoints.
Personal History and Influence
Waters talks about his father Eric, a World War II conscientious objector who later fought and died in Italy.
Waters reflects on advice from his mother about reading extensively and doing the right thing.
Waters' Views on Israel and Genocide
Waters categorically condemns Israel's actions in Gaza, calling it genocide.
Insists that the state of Israel should apologize and reconsider their policies for peace in the region.
Discusses the historical and ongoing conflict, emphasizing the humanitarian crisis in Gaza.
Criticism and Controversy
Waters faces criticism for his contentious views, including accusations of anti-Semitism from former band members and public figures.
He defends himself by stating that his advocacy is grounded in universal human rights, not targetted against any specific group.
Bono's tribute to Israeli victims at a music festival is criticized by Waters, deepening the debate about alignment with Zionist entities.
Waters on Judaism and Anti-Semitism
Refutes claims of anti-Semitism, insisting he holds no negative feelings towards Jews.
Highlights his lifelong advocacy for human rights and his belief in treating everyone equally.
Views on Conflicts and World Politics
Waters discusses the Ukraine-Russia conflict, expressing skepticism about Western narratives and motivations.
Emphasizes his views on the necessity for a thorough investigation into the events of October 7th, 2023 in Israel.
Calls for a complete overhaul of the American political system, criticizing both Donald Trump and Joe Biden.
Personal Life and Reflections
Reflects on his multiple marriages and his understanding of true love as finding a soulmate.
Touches on his relationship with his children and their influence on his life and career.
Conclusion
Waters concludes by emphasizing the importance of fighting for human rights and understanding what is right and wrong.
Encourages people to support candidates who share these values in political elections.
